Experiments for Distributed and Networked Dynamic Resource Allocation, Scheduling, and Control

نویسندگان

  • Nicanor Quijano
  • Alvaro E. Gil
  • Kevin M. Passino
چکیده

Introduction Advances in information technology such as object-oriented programming, real-time operating systems, and reliable computer communication networks, enable the deployment of effective control and automation systems [1]. Industry exploits information technology in distributed control system (DCS) products [2], whose components include proportional-integral-derivative (PID) and programmable logic (PLC) controllers. At the same time, DCSs can utilize distributed networked decision-making systems for factory-wide control solutions. There is an ongoing technological revolution in the application of networked embedded computing to control [3]. Advancements in this area are being driven by (i) low-cost and high-performance microcontrollers that have onboard data acquisition, and (ii) the controller area network (CAN) or wireless ethernet technologies that interconnect these microcontrollers. There are software tools for developing and implementing such embedded 1 distributed networked control systems [3]. The co-design of software and feedback controls for both DCS and networked embedded controls is a topic of current investigation for control and software engineers [1]. While industry continues to exploit information technology for distributed feedback control , universities face the challenge of revising their curricula to suit the educational needs of future engineers in this area. We can identify two research thrusts that support relevant educational experiences. First, there is the area of cooperative robotics where groups of ground, underwater, flying, or space robots are given tasks such as cooperative search, cooperative pushing of an object, or coordinated group motion. In these applications, there is typically a microcontroller on each vehicle, and a wireless ethernet supports vehicle-to-vehicle communications. University courses that provide educational experiences in this area are described in [4], [5]. Second, there is the research program on wireless sensor networks based on the University of California Berkeley motes, which are electronic modules that have a processor, sensors, and communication capabilities [6]. Networks of motes can be used for distributed networked control system problems, such as the tracking of an evader moving through a field of sensors. This article introduces a third approach to distributed networked feedback control based on an educational laboratory. This laboratory emphasizes: (i) low-cost experiments that retain key elements of realism; (ii) problems that are different from those studied in the cooperative robotics and sensor network areas; and (iii) new challenges from information 2 technology-enabled feedback control [1], [7], such as dynamic resource allocation, feedback scheduling of tasks, decision-making over networks, and nontraditional control objectives. We have developed the following experiments to study these challenges [8]: …

برای دانلود رایگان متن کامل این مقاله و بیش از 32 میلیون مقاله دیگر ابتدا ثبت نام کنید

ثبت نام

اگر عضو سایت هستید لطفا وارد حساب کاربری خود شوید

منابع مشابه

Experiments for Decentralized and Networked Dynamic Resource Allocation, Scheduling, and Control

The ubiquitous presence of networked computing is significantly impacting the field of control systems. There are already many distributed control systems (DCS) in industry and significant current research on networked multi agent systems. These networked control systems are often viewed as “complicated” since they are typically decentralized, large-scale, and hierarchical. Moreover, they typic...

متن کامل

Uncertain Resource Availabilities: Proactive and Reactive Procedures for Preemptive Resource Constrained project Scheduling Problem

Project scheduling is the part of project management that deals with determining when intime to start (and finish) which activities and with the allocation of scarce resources to theproject activities. In practice, virtually all project managers are confronted with resourcescarceness. In such cases, the Resource-Constrained Project Scheduling Problem (RCPSP)arises. This optimization problem has...

متن کامل

Multi-objective and Scalable Heuristic Algorithm for Workflow Task Scheduling in Utility Grids

 To use services transparently in a distributed environment, the Utility Grids develop a cyber-infrastructure. The parameters of the Quality of Service such as the allocation-cost and makespan have to be dealt with in order to schedule workflow application tasks in the Utility Grids. Optimization of both target parameters above is a challenge in a distributed environment and may conflict one an...

متن کامل

Experiments for Dynamic Resource Allocation

dvances in information technology such as object-oriented programming, realtime operating systems, and reliable computer communication networks enable the deployment of effective control and automation systems [1]. Industry exploits information technology in distributed control system (DCS) products, whose components include proportional-integral-derivative (PID) and programmable logic controll...

متن کامل

Integrated modeling and solving the resource allocation problem and task scheduling in the cloud computing environment

Cloud computing is considered to be a new service provider technology for users and businesses. However, the cloud environment is facing a number of challenges. Resource allocation in a way that is optimum for users and cloud providers is difficult because of lack of data sharing between them. On the other hand, job scheduling is a basic issue and at the same time a big challenge in reaching hi...

متن کامل

ذخیره در منابع من


  با ذخیره ی این منبع در منابع من، دسترسی به آن را برای استفاده های بعدی آسان تر کنید

عنوان ژورنال:

دوره   شماره 

صفحات  -

تاریخ انتشار 2004